Job Summary The Electrical Foreman is responsible for leading and supporting electrical crews on agricultural construction projects, including grain systems and farm facilities. This role oversees all on-site electrical activities while ensuring work is completed safely, on time, within budget, and to Summit quality standards. Duties/Responsibilities Schedule, assign, and supervise all electrical activities on the jobsite Lead and support electrical crews while maintaining strong jobsite morale Review work requests, determine labor and material needs, and set priorities Ensure compliance with NEC, project specifications, and quality standards Inspect work in progress and completed installations for accuracy and quality Enforce safety policies and OSHA regulations Manage procurement and staging of electrical materials and equipment Monitor crew performance and provide coaching as needed Maintain clean, organized, and efficient jobsites Perform other duties as assigned Required Skills / Abilities Strong leadership and crew management skills Excellent organization and problem-solving abilities Safety-oriented mindset Ability to read blueprints and electrical plans Ability to work independently Willingness to work extended hours (5565 per week) Ability to work outdoors in all conditions Ability to travel as needed Education / Experience Nebraska Journeyman Electrician license (required) OSHA 10 required; OSHA 30 preferred 2+ years electrical field experience Proven leadership experience Bachelor's or associate degree in electrical Field preferred Physical Requirements Ability to lift and handle heavy materials Ability to work at heights Ability to wear PPE Ability to work in varying weather conditions Our Benefits Package Includes Health and Dental Coverage PTO and Holiday Pay 401(k) with Company Match Company Clothing Allowance Short- and Long-Term Disability Insurance Life Insurance MondayFriday Work Schedule Our Core Values: We've Got Each Other's Backs First and foremost, we are a team.
